Dickinson - Theodore Roosevelt Regional Airport (DIK)

  • General
  • Type: Airport, Status: Operational, Acivation Date: 10/01/1938, Runways: 2, Land Area Covered By Airport: 626 acres, Ownership: Publicly owned, Facility Use: Open to public, Site Number: 17304.*A, Location ID: DIK, Region: Great Lakes, District Office: DMA, Unicom Frequency: 123.000 MHz, Common Traffic Advisory Frequency (CTAF): 123.000 MHz, Aeronautical sectional chart: Billings, Tie-In FSS ID: GFK, Tie-In FSS Name: Grand Forks, Tie-In FSS Toll-Free Number: 1-800-WX-BRIEF, Elevation: 2592 ft, Elevation determination method: Surveyed, Elevation Source: 3RD PARTY SURVEY (2008-09-06), Air traffic control tower: No, Boundary ARTCC (FAA) computer ID: ZCP, Boundary ARTCC ID: ZMP, Boundary ARTCC Name: Minneapolis, Airspace Determination: No Objection, Certification Type & Date: I A S 07/2006, Federal Agreements: NGY3, NOTAM Service: Yes, NOTAM Facility ID: DIK, Last Inspection Date: 08/19/2015, Inspection Group: FAA airports field personnel, Inspection Method: State
  • Location
  • State: North Dakota, County: Stark, City: Dickinson, GPS (Degrees): Lat: 46° 47' 50.400'', Lng: -102° 48' 06.700'', GPS (Seconds): Lat: 46.797333, Lng: -102.801861, GPS determination method: Estimated, Position Source: 3RD PARTY SURVEY (2008-09-06), Distance from central business district: 5 mi (S) Find on map
  • Owner
  • Dickinson Arpt Authority, 11120 42nd St Sw, Dickinson, Nd 58601-9282, 701-483-1062
  • Manager
  • Kelly Braun, 11120 42nd St Sw, Dickinson, Nd 58601-9282, 701-483-1062
  • Operations
  • Period: 08/19/2014 - 08/19/2015, Commercial Operations: 3,548, Air Taxi Operations: 1,125, Itinerant Operations: 8,320, Local Operations: 3,223, Military Operations: 120
  • Aircraft
  • Single Engine Aircraft: 28, Multi Engine Aircraft: 4, Jet Engine Aircraft: 1, Helicopters: 1
  • Additional
  • Fuel Types: 100LLA, Magnetic Variation: 10E (Year 2000), Beacon Color: Clear-green (lighted land airport), Lighting Schedule: See Rmk, Beacon Schedule: Ss-Sr, Airframe repair service availability/type: Major, Power Plant repair service availability/type: Major, Customs Airport Of Entry: No, Customs Landing Rights: No, Military/civil joint use agreement: No, Military Landing Rights: Yes, Non-Commercial Landing Fee: No, Transient storage: HGR,TIE, Wind direction indicator: Y-L, Segmented circle airport marker system: Yes, Other services: AGRI, AMB, CHTR, INSTR, RNTL, SALES, SURV
  • Remarks
  • Traffic Pattern Altitude: TPA SINGLE ENGINE 1010 FT AGL; MULTI-ENGINE 1510 FT AGL.
